Undesirable Side Effects of Duolube Eye Ointment.


Duolube Eye ointment may temporarily sting your eyes when first applied. If this continues or becomes bothersome or the condition for which this was prescribed does not improve within several days, inform your doctor. 

Vision may be temporarily unstable for a few minutes after applying this. Use caution if driving or performing duties requiring clear vision. Notify your doctor if you develop a skin rash, itching, eye pain or redness in or around the eyes, or a headache while using Duolube Eye ointments. If you notice other effects not listed above, contact your doctor or pharmacist.

Side effects not requiring immediate medical attention

Some side effects of ocular lubricant ophthalmic may occur that usually do not need medical attention. These side effects may go away during treatment as your body adjusts to the medicine. Also, your health care professional may be able to tell you about ways to prevent or reduce some of these side effects.

Check with your health care professional if any of the following side effects continue or are bothersome or if you have any questions about them:

Less common

  • Blurred vision
  • eye redness or discomfort or other irritation not present before the use of this medicine
  • increased sensitivity of eyes to light
  • matting or stickiness of eyelashes
  • swelling of eyelids
  • watering of eyes
